Block 807,662
Block Hash
019885f434a2b0eeeda6dc5a8714661d3dc5f360920b4746afa92291ae63c8d4
Previous Block Hash
4c259790d586566261dc28f4d2d4adcf48f91c39a8e4adf6f9a36bee38af8f38
Mined
Transactions
3
Difficulty
61.59 M
Size
589 bytes
Transactions (3)
1 input, 1 output
10,000.0244
PEPE
1 input, 2 outputs
11,121,329.70947937
PEPE
1 input, 1 output
599.9901
PEPE